    Brandon had a modest childhood, he was raised at a small community just outside Adria by his mother Eleanor and father Dustin a Hansetian highlander who ran away from its culture now working as farmers for the local lord. Brandon didn't have too many friends and their family wasn't very rich but they were happy nevertheless, one night however he woke up to his parents arguing. When sneaking downstairs he still couldn't really make out what they were saying, still worried but not wanting to escalate the situation even further he went back to sleep. The next day however he jumped up from his bed after hearing a loud bang and people yelling, when running downstairs he saw his dad being dragged away by what seemed to be soldiers. 14-year-old Brandon ran up trying to get between the soldiers, but he just wasn't strong enough to reach his dad. *Brandon's father shouted one last thing with a big smile to him before being pushed into the closed horse cart* “Take care son, and watch your mother while I am away.”. Brandon turned around seeing his mother wrecked on the ground sobbing in tears. For the next 2 years, she had been unresponsive and stayed in bed for most of the day, so Brandon had to keep the farm running which seemed like an impossible job most of the time. Most of the villagers had their own business to handle and didn't have time to help the Solomons, on top of that were the taxes also though the roof to fund the military in The Adrian-Curonian War. If the situation couldn't have been any worse his mother also got sick and after 2 months eventually died from the illness. Brandon was on rock bottom he had but an empty house and an overgrown farm, it seemed like all hope was lost. He decided to sell the house and the farm to join the military and find his father. Brandon was not a very social person but was still a force to be reckoned with when wielding a sword. His fellow soldiers may have mocked him at first but this quickly stopped after there first encounter close to the Curon Borders. Because of his large posture, raw strength from all the work on the farm and 20-pound great sword was he nicknamed Brandon the Bane after that. However, the new title didn't change his motives for joining the army. He still tried to follow the rumors of his father whereabouts and seemed to come a bit closer by every person he spoke about the matter. It was but 15 years later when he reached a dead-end, he found the platoon his father served in but they were all dead or missing only existing on a piece of paper in a dusty archive. Not Dustin, however, he couldn't find the name Dustin, Dustin, page after page Dustin Solomons was not on it nowhere to be found. After that day it didn't take him long to resign from the military having served his duty more than well he became a traveling merchant roaming from town to town still following the rumors.
